How Cover Letter Sales Samples Can Make Or Break You

Cover letter sales samples stands out in a class by itself. It is still a cover letter, but it is something that must generate a sale of yourself instead of a mere job opportunity. Just like other cover letter samples, a cover letter sales sample must be formal, catchy, brief and free of any grammatical or typographical errors. You can definitely expect a lot to come out as a result of your cover letter sales sample. That is also a big reason why it is widely being offered online and offline. Cover letter sales samples never cease to exist for as long as there are people looking for jobs and services to sell others.

Cover letter sales samples are quite special since this is not just an usher for your resume, but also an initial test of your selling skills. Imagine that your cover letter sales sample is something that will help you sell yourself to your employer. Now is not the time to be candid. You definitely ought to have an aggressive and assertive approach in order for you to get leverage for these kinds of job openings. While the competition in most industries are already stiff, consider the application to this position to be a notch higher than most service-oriented companies.

A good cover letter sales sample has ample but not too many revealing information. The competition in the arena of cover letter sales is very fierce and stiff. A lot of people would want to engage in the business in sales because that's where the biggest commissions are. And usually, the people who apply with this kind of cover letter sample are those who are hustlers in the area of selling and are most likely to be doing a lot of self-marketing in their letters to be picked. If you want to succeed in getting a sales position, you must be able to rise above or at least be at par with the highly qualified people who file their cover letters.

Believe it or not, there are cover letter sales samples that can break your chances. An ill-fitted sales sample, for example, will eradicate your chances of bagging the position. You must be able to estimate effectively what kind of cover letter sales sample will work best for the specific sales job you have in mind. While it is extremely easy to just rely on the cover letter sales sample, it is still so much better to come up with your own means and devices.

If ever you will be using cover letter sales samples, you must still be willing to modify them and make them more personalized for your needs. If you are able to do this effectively, then you will not have missed the opportunity to be original with your approach. This will certainly get the attention of your potential employer. Take into account your unique blend of characteristics that can add flavor to an otherwise bland cover letter sales sample: your experiences, the things you are capable of doing and the potential you have to grow if you are given this position. Concocting them together to form your cover letter will definitely up your chances of being interviewed and getting that job. The fact that you are applying for a sales job means you inherently have that ability to sell yourself. All you have to do is unleash that confidence as early as in constructing your cover letter and you will not get lost.
